0% found this document useful (0 votes)
63 views7 pages

MIS Lecture 10 Software 3

This document discusses different types of computer software. It describes important system management programs like performance monitors and security monitors that help run computer systems efficiently and securely. It also discusses middleware that allows different software applications to exchange data. The document then explains programming languages from first to fifth generation languages and how they have evolved to be more user-friendly. It lists some popular object-oriented programming languages like Visual Basic, C++ and Java. Finally, it mentions some web languages and programming software packages.

Uploaded by

ShihabAkhand
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
63 views7 pages

MIS Lecture 10 Software 3

This document discusses different types of computer software. It describes important system management programs like performance monitors and security monitors that help run computer systems efficiently and securely. It also discusses middleware that allows different software applications to exchange data. The document then explains programming languages from first to fifth generation languages and how they have evolved to be more user-friendly. It lists some popular object-oriented programming languages like Visual Basic, C++ and Java. Finally, it mentions some web languages and programming software packages.

Uploaded by

ShihabAkhand
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 7

Lecture 10

Software
MGT 301 (Fall 2014)

Instructor
M Anwar Hossain
Associate Professor

Notice Board

Management Information
System

MIS

Computer Software
Important System management programs:

Performance monitors are programs that


monitor and adjust performance and usage to run the
computer system efficiently.

Security monitors are programs that monitor and


control the use of computer systems and provide
warning messages and record unauthorized use of
computer resources.

Middleware is a software that helps diverse


software applications and networked computer
systems exchange data and work together more
efficiently.

Programming Language
Programming language allows a
programmer to develop the sets of
instructions that constitute a program.
A programming language has its own
unique vocabulary, grammar, and uses.

Programming Languages
Machine Languages (First generation languages):
Use binary coded instructions.
Assembler Languages (Second generation
languages): Use symbolic coded instructions.
High Level Languages (Third generation languages):
Use brief statements or arithmetic notations.
Fourth Generation Languages: Use natural and non
procedural statements.

Programming Languages
Object Oriented Programming Languages:
Visual Basic, C++, Java are considered to be Fifth
generation languages and are being used
widely. OOP are easy to use having GUI (graphical
user interface)

Web Languages and services: HTML, XML,


and Java are used to create multimedia web pages,
websites, and web based applications.

Programming Software packages are available


to help programmers develop computer programs.

You might also like